Me in front, Gabriel Silva on the left, Debuchy on the right and Ruffier behind … At the center of this quartet of experience, two youngsters, 37 years old between them! Such was the team from Saint-Etienne here two weeks ago in Monaco and the experiment was successful since the princely goleadors did not succeed in piercing the green defense, in this case the central Saliba / Fofana axis: “C ‘was a small risk taking because they had in front of them sacred customers. But I wanted to know if they could assume such things, to manage an important match “, justifies Claude Puel.

Never before, the two green nuggets had not been associated without the reassuring presence of Loïc Perrin at their sides and this first confirmed the talent of the interested parties, a talent which nobody in reality doubted: “They still have quite a lot to learn, but they’re off to a good start. They have already shown that they have a certain maturity in their game, “observes an admiring Mathieu Debuchy.

Loïc Perrin is no less: “They are two very good players. William (Saliba) will be leaving us for a very large club (Arsenal, editor’s note) and Wesley (Fofana), which we have discovered this season on a professional level, has progressed enormously “, appreciates their captain.

Puel: “We are trying to professionalize them”

This hinge could have been that of the next green seasons … It will not be since one already belongs to Arsenal, while the other is in the sights of the great European teams.

Too bad, because Puel would have liked to shape and polish them in order to rely on them to build the ASSE of the future: “They are under construction. They stay young and we try to professionalize them, to make them progress in all areas, defensive, technical, tactical “, explains the Stéphanois coach.

So, failing to count on this duo for the future, Puel will, more and more often, trust them until the end of the season with the hope of finally solidifying this defense which, with already 37 goals conceded, is the 18e Ligue 1, only Amiens and Toulouse doing worse. It will not be too much to hope to grab a few places in the ranking and find a rank more in line with the objectives and budget of the club.

THE STAY WILL NOT FALL!

ASSE is under threat of a closed match and it was feared that the incidents, violent enough to require the intervention of the police and the use of tear gas bombs and a water cannon, which have opposed some supporters of Saint-Etienne and Marseille on Wednesday do not drop it.

It will not be anything since, the clashes having taken place outside the enclosure of Geoffroy-Guichard, they escape the responsibility of the club.

Good news for the Greens who need their audience more than ever.
